What’s Included in the Tour
The canyoning tour comes with a full set of essential gear, including a neoprene wetsuit, a safety helmet, and a secure harness. Professional instructors will be on hand to supervise participants throughout the adventure. Participants should also bring their own swimsuit and appropriate shoes for the activity.

Meeting Point and Pickup
Participants meet at the designated meeting point of 4 Rte des Gorges du Loup, 06620 Gourdon, France.
A shuttle service is available from the meeting point to transport participants to the start of the canyoning activity.
The tour ends at the same location as the meeting point, so participants can conveniently return to their starting point.

Cancellation and Refund Policy
Cancelations up to 24 hours in advance are fully refundable, but changes made less than 24 hours before the start time aren’t accepted.
If the activity is canceled due to poor weather, an alternative date or a full refund will be offered.
Similarly, if the minimum number of participants isn’t met, the company will either provide an alternative experience or issue a full refund.

Exploring the Loup Gorges
Nestled in the heart of Provence, the Gorges du Loup offer canyoning enthusiasts a thrilling adventure through its rugged, natural terrain. Descending into the dramatically carved limestone gorge, participants navigate a series of rappels, jumps, and slides, seeing the area’s stunning geological formations and refreshing, crystal-clear waters.
The Loup Gorges are renowned for:
Their diverse landscapes, ranging from towering cliffs to tranquil pools and cascading waterfalls.
The abundance of wildlife, including birds of prey, wild goats, and vibrant flora that line the canyon walls.
The challenging, yet exhilarating canyoning routes that test participants’ skills and courage, providing an unforgettable experience.
